May 5, 1948 – December 4, 2023

Linda “Lin” Ovelyn Nelms, 75, of Leesburg, Florida, passed away on Monday, December 4, 2023.

A Miami native, Lin was in the first graduating class of Miami Coral Park Senior High School. She attended Scarritt-Bennett College for Christian Workers in Nashville, graduating with a Bachelors and Masters in Christian Education. She worked as a Christian educator in Rome, Georgia, and Haines City, Palma Ceia in Tampa, and Miami, Florida. Lin worked as a secretary and event planner in Miami and Coral Gables. After marrying her husband, Darrell, and having a son, Jonathan, Lin earned another Master’s Degree in Education from Florida International University. She worked as a library media specialist for Miami-Dade Public Schools for nineteen years. Lin was an Alpha Delta Kappa sister and former chapter president. After retiring from Pine Lake Elementary she deepened her involvement with her church, First United Methodist Church of Coral Gables.

In 2017, Lin moved with her husband to Leesburg, FL, where she was active in Morrison United Methodist Church and in the Fellowship of Worship Artists. Lin loved the natural world and travel. She loved orchids, fabric crafts, and finely wrought ornaments and place settings. She loved music; she sang and she played the viola and handbells. Lin is predeceased by parents Ralph and Sarah Nelms, and survived by her husband, Darrell Miles, and her son, Jonathan Miles.
